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water spill (less than 1 gallon) | Yes | No | You can clean up the spill yourself and prevent further damage. |
| Standing water in your basement (up to 2 inches deep) | Maybe | Yes | It’s better to call a professional to ensure the water is removed safely and efficiently. |
| Water damage affecting multiple rooms or floors | No | A professional has the equipment and expertise to handle large-scale water removal and restoration. | |
| Hidden water damage behind walls or ceilings | No | A professional can detect and repair hidden water damage, preventing further damage and health risks. | |
| Water damage affecting electrical systems or appliances | No | A professional can safely repair or replace electrical systems and appliances, ensuring your property is safe and secure. | |
| Water damage affecting your home’s foundation or structure | No | A professional can assess and repair any structural damage, ensuring your home’s foundation is safe and secure. |

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al Cost in Live Oak, TX
The cost of hydrostatic pressure water removal in Live Oak, TX, depends on various factors, including the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team will provide you with a free estimate after assessing the damage.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Removal (up to 2 inches deep) | $500 – $2,500 | The size of the affected area and the type of equipment needed.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of equipment needed. |
| Restoration and Repairs | $1,000 – $5,000 | The extent of the damage and the materials needed for repairs. |
